MARYLAND, That Section 9C[[(f)]] (g) of Article 81 -
Revenue and Taxes, of the Annotated Code of Maryland
(1969 Replacement Volume and 1974 Supplement) be and it
is hereby repealed and re—enacted, with amendments, to
read as follows:
Article 81 — Revenue and Taxes
9C.
[[(f)(1) In Calvert County [[and]], Carroll
County, ALLEGANY COUNTY, BALTIMORE COUNTY, FREDERICK
COUNTY, GARRETT COUNTY, KENT COUNTY, AND QUEEN ANNE'S
COUNTY from county taxation only, real property owned by
a nonprofit community or civic improvement association or
corporation, which is devoted to and used exclusively for
community, civic, educational, or library purposes, and
where such use is not contingent upon the payment of any
fee or other compensation, and failure to pay any such
fee or other compensation is not a reason to deny
admission to or use of this property. Assessments
exacted and employed by the association or corporation
solely for the improvement or maintenance of the property
are not "fees or other compensation" under the terms of
this paragraph.
(2) IN CARROLL COUNTY, ALLEGANY COUNTY, BALTIMORE
COUNTY, FREDERICK COUNTY, GARRETT COUNTY, KENT COUNTY,
AND QUEEN ANNE'S COUNTY, FROM COUNTY TAXATION ONLY, SILOS
USED [[PREDOMINATELY]] FOR PROCESSING OR STORAGE OF
ANIMAL FEED INCIDENTAL TO THE OPERATION OF THE FARM ON
WHICH THE SILO IS LOCATED.]]
(g) In Cecil County, (1) real and tangible
personal property owned by the Society for the
Preservation of Maryland Antiquities, Inc.; AND (2) real
and tangible personal property owned by the Friends of
the Library of Cecil County, Maryland, Inc. [: and (3)
silos used predominantly for processing or storage of
animal feed incidental to operation of the farm on which
the silo is located].
